Posted on 5/9/16 at 8:06 pm to doublecutter
right click your network on bottom right screen
open network
click on "local network"
Click on properties
Find Internet Protocol Version 4
Click properties
Click use following DNS
Preferred: 8.8.8.8
Alt 8.8.4.4
Close browser
Open back up and should work
